Downham Market
Downham Market is a market town in Norfolk, . It lies on the edge
of the Fens, on the River Great Ouse, some 11 miles south of King's
Lynn, 39 miles west of Norwich and 30 miles north of
Cambridge.[2]There is a main line train station which has direct
routes through to Ely, Cambridge and London Kings Cross every
hour.
It was an agricultural centre, developing as a market for the
produce of the Fens with a bridge across the Ouse. During the
Middle Ages, it was famed for its butter market and also hosted a
notable horse fair. The market is now held Fridays and Saturdays on
the town hall car park.
Notable buildings in the town include its medieval parish church,
dedicated to St Edmund, and Victorian clock tower, constructed in
1878.
In 2004 the town completed a regeneration project on the Market
Place, moving the market to the town hall car park. The decorative
town sign depicts the crown and arrows of St Edmund with horses to
show the importance of the horse fairs in the town's history.
Over the past few decades, Downham Market has grown from being a
quiet market town to a busy town with supermarkets, cafes and
restaurants. The area is brim full of historic buildings and
amazing architecture. Discover why Downham Market has its nickname
'Gingerbread Town' (due to its buildings made from local carstone)
and saunter through the countryside to explore fascinating nearby
villages.
There are two primary schools in Downham Market; Nelson Academy,
which has a nursery for children aged 3-5, and Hillcrest Primary
School. The town has one secondary school, Downham Market Academy
which includes a sixth form on a separate site. The Downham Market
Leisure Centre is sited on the Downham Market Academy site with
swimming pool, gym and activities/classes.
